India, Feb. 16 -- Rajasthan may soon follow Maharshtra and Assam's footsteps in uniforming dress code for the school teachers. The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) government is planning to introduce a uniform dress code for the school teachers in the state, a senior official from the education ministry department said on Saturday.

"The minister of the education department, Madan Dilawar, is serious about ensuring a positive environment for the students in the classrooms so that they learn proper values and cultures in life.
